Gtak Capital is a Madrid-based private equity firm investing in early-stage and growth companies across Spain and Europe.
Gtak Capital
GTAK Capital is a technology advisory and investment firm based in Madrid, Spain. It has made two investments. The firm invested in Backspin Games as part of their Series B on November 16, 2021.
